Ensconced in rep at the National, the play briefly toured to Bristol Hippodrome in September 1977 and would run within the Lyttelton until 17 August 1978; initial expectations were the play would close in February 1978. Its success, nonetheless, generated its personal problems as there was an virtually quick clamour for the play by the regional repertory theatres. Naturally, the National turned down all such requests aside from the Nottingham Playhouse. On 29 September 1977, the primary professional rep production opened at that theatre with the obvious blessing of the National.

He has written and produced seventy-three full-length performs in Scarborough and London and was, between 1972 and 2009, the artistic director of the Stephen Joseph Theatre in Scarborough, the place all however 4 of his performs have obtained their first performance. More than forty have subsequently been produced in the West End, on the Royal National Theatre or by the Royal Shakespeare Company since his first hit Relatively Speaking opened at the Duke of York's Theatre in 1967. Major successes embody Absurd Person Singular , The Norman Conquests trilogy , Bedroom Farce , Just Between Ourselves , A Chorus of Disapproval , Woman in Mind , A Small Family Business , Man Of The Moment , House & Garden and Private Fears in Public Places . His plays have won quite a few awards, including seven London Evening Standard Awards. They have been translated into over 35 languages and are carried out on stage and tv throughout the world. Ten of his plays have been staged on Broadway, attracting two Tony nominations, and one Tony award.

Place premieredThe Library Theatre, Scarborough, United KingdomOriginal languageEnglishGenreBedroom farceSettingThree bedroomsBedroom Farce is a 1975 play by British playwright Alan Ayckbourn. It had a London production on the Prince of Wales Theatre in 1978. Although a seemingly strange match, a strong ensemble company led by Nicholas le Provost and Jane Asher as Ernest and Delia, beneath the direction of Hall, proved very successful and the play was critically acclaimed.

There is way humour within the play, though few if any of the standard conventions of farce are observed. The play takes place in three bedrooms during one night and the following morning. The complicating issue is that Jan was once Trevor's girlfriend, and after Susannah and Trevor have a blazing row, Susannah finds Trevor kissing Jan. As a outcome Susannah leaves the party and goes to go to Delia and Ernest, whose reference to the the rest of the plot is that they are Trevor's mother and father; she ends up sharing Delia's mattress, whereas Ernest is compelled to sleep in the spare room.
